Wagering Calculation
Understanding wagering requirements is the most critical technical skill for managing bonuses. Let’s break it down with a real-world example.
Assume you claim a 100% deposit match bonus up to $200 with a 40x wagering requirement on the “bonus amount.” You deposit $100, receiving a $100 bonus. Your total playable balance becomes $200.
The Formula: Bonus Amount ($100) × Wagering Requirement (40x) = Total Wagering Required ($4,000).
You must place bets totaling $4,000 before the bonus money and any winnings from it can be withdrawn. Not all games contribute 100% to this requirement. Slots often cont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ack or roulette might contribute only 10% or 5%.
Example with Game Weighting: If you play only European Roulette (hypothetical 10% contribution), every $10 bet only counts as $1 toward your $4,000 requirement. To clear the bonus this way, you would need to bet $40,000 in real money—a nearly impossible task.
Maximum Bet Limit: Bonus terms almost always include a maximum bet limit while the bonus is active, often $5 or 10% of the bonus amount. Exceeding this can void the bonus and any winnings.
Security Overview
A secure gaming environment protects your funds and personal data. Reputable operators implement several key technologies.
- Encryption: The website should use SSL (Secure Socket Layer) encryption, indicated by “https://” and a padlock icon in the address bar. This encrypts all data transfers.
- Fair Gaming Certification: Look for certification from independent testing agencies like eCOGRA, iTech Labs, or GLI. Their seals indicate that the Random Number Generators (RNGs) for slots and games are truly random and fair.
- Financial Security: Segregated player accounts ensure that customer deposits are kept separate from the casino’s operational funds. This protects your money in the unlikely event of company insolvency.
- Personal Security: In addition to strong passwords and 2FA, robust platforms employ advanced firewalls and intrusion detection systems to prevent unauthorized access to their servers.
Money In, Money Out
Managing your bankroll effectively means understanding the payment lifecycle. Here is a comparative overview of common methods.
| Payment Method | Typical Deposit Time | Typical Withdrawal Time |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Credit/Debit Card (Visa/Mastercard) | Instant | 1–3 banking days | Widely accepted; withdrawals are returned to the card used for deposit. |
| E-Wallet (Skrill, Neteller) | Instant | 0–24 hours | Fastest withdrawals; sometimes excluded from bonus offers. |
| Bank Transfer | 1–3 banking days | 3–5 banking days | High reliability but slower processing times. |
| Prepaid Voucher (Paysafecard) | Instant | Not available | Deposit-only method; withdrawals must go to an alternative method. |
When Things Go Wrong
Even on the best platforms, you might encounter issues. Here’s how to troubleshoot common scenarios.
- Bonus Not Credited: First, check if you needed to activate the bonus in the cashier or enter a code. Ensure you met the minimum deposit. Finally, review the T&Cs to confirm your deposit method was eligible.
- Withdrawal Delayed: The most common cause is pending KYC verification. Submit any requested documents promptly. Other causes include not meeting wagering requirements or reaching weekly/monthly withdrawal limits.
- Game Malfunction: If a game freezes or errors during play, do not refresh immediately. Take a screenshot showing the game ID and timestamp. Contact support with these details; game histories are logged and can be reviewed.
- Suspicious Account Activity: If you notice unfamiliar login attempts or transactions, change your password immediately and contact support to secure your account. Enable 2FA if you haven’t already.
- Disputed Game Outcome: If you believe a game result was incorrect, note the exact time, game name, and bet ID. Support can request a game log from the provider to investigate the specific round.

Quick Answers
What happens if I don’t meet the wagering requirements?
The bonus funds and any winnings generated from them will be forfeited from your account once the bonus expires, which is typically after 7 to 30 days.
Can I withdraw my deposit before clearing a bonus?
Usually, no. Most bonus terms state that making a withdrawal before fulfilling wagering will result in the immediate cancellation of the active bonus and any associated winnings.
Are free spins winnings subject to wagering?
Almost always, yes. Winnings from no-deposit or deposit-triggered free spins are typically credited as bonus money with their own wagering requirements attached.
Why is my withdrawal being returned to my deposit method?
This is a standard anti-money laundering (AML) practice known as “Return to Source.” Operators are required to return funds to the method used for deposit, at least for the initial amount deposited.
What is a “withdrawal limit”?
This is the maximum amount you can withdraw within a given timeframe (e.g., weekly or monthly). It’s separate from any “max win” cap that might apply to bonus funds.
How do I know if a game is contributing to wagering?
The game’s contribution percentage (e.g., 100%, 10%, 0%) should be listed in the bonus terms and conditions. You can also check the information icon within the game lobby on the casino site.
Is it safe to provide my ID documents online?
When submitted through a secure, encrypted portal to a licensed operator, it is standard and safe practice. It is a regulatory requirement to prevent fraud and underage gambling.
